### Runbook: Pool exhaustion on Dovetail

If the Dovetail API starts throwing connection timeouts, odds are the pgpool tier is saturated again — we've seen this after every big import from the Harrow batch jobs. First, check pool stats via the internal Poolwatch dashboard; if active connections sit above 90%, bump the ceiling in the overrides file and restart workers one at a time, not all at once. Poolwatch's stats endpoint requires auth, and the key for that service is below.

app token of yajof-fajof = zpat11_OrsDd3gqCaG

To: Branch Managers
Subject: Halverton plant capacity

Decision made: Halverton line 3 converts to Arcten housings by Q2. No second shift this year. Overflow routes to the Dunmoor site. Branch forecasts above committed volume need my approval before quoting. Lead times hold at six weeks. Plan inventory accordingly. The reasoning connects to the confidential direction stated just below.

board note of fahag-tajop: The eastern region missed its Julix quota by 44.0 percent last quarter. Ralionax Holdings plans to lower the Druath list price by 61.8 percent in March. The board signed off on a budget of $295.0 million for Project Gilath. The renewal with Ruswynix Systems closes at $274.5 million a year, 17.0 percent above the last contract.

## Deploying the Gatewick Proctor Queue

Deploys are pretty painless: push to main, wait for the pipeline, then watch the queue drain dashboard for five minutes. If candidates pile up mid-exam, roll back first and ask questions later — the queue replays safely. Everything the workers care about lives in one config block, shown here for reference.

settings of bafof-yagef:
JOROX_PIN=8740
JOROX_TENANT=pelox
JOROX_METRICS_HOST=metrics.jorox.qorvelworks.internal
JOROX_SEAL=seal_c78f63c1
JOROX_STANDBY_TEAM=norax